Step-by-Step: How to Find the Divisors of 2160

An efficient way to find divisors uses the complementary pair trick: check each integer i from 1 to √2160 ≈ 46.48. If i divides 2160, then both i and 2160/i are divisors.

  1. 1 divides 2160 (2160 ÷ 1 = 2160) → pair (1, 2160)
  2. 2 divides 2160 (2160 ÷ 2 = 1080) → pair (2, 1080)
  3. 3 divides 2160 (2160 ÷ 3 = 720) → pair (3, 720)
  4. 4 divides 2160 (2160 ÷ 4 = 540) → pair (4, 540)
  5. 5 divides 2160 (2160 ÷ 5 = 432) → pair (5, 432)
  6. 6 divides 2160 (2160 ÷ 6 = 360) → pair (6, 360)
  7. 8 divides 2160 (2160 ÷ 8 = 270) → pair (8, 270)
  8. 9 divides 2160 (2160 ÷ 9 = 240) → pair (9, 240)
  9. 10 divides 2160 (2160 ÷ 10 = 216) → pair (10, 216)
  10. 12 divides 2160 (2160 ÷ 12 = 180) → pair (12, 180)
  11. 15 divides 2160 (2160 ÷ 15 = 144) → pair (15, 144)
  12. 16 divides 2160 (2160 ÷ 16 = 135) → pair (16, 135)
  13. 18 divides 2160 (2160 ÷ 18 = 120) → pair (18, 120)
  14. 20 divides 2160 (2160 ÷ 20 = 108) → pair (20, 108)
  15. 24 divides 2160 (2160 ÷ 24 = 90) → pair (24, 90)
  16. 27 divides 2160 (2160 ÷ 27 = 80) → pair (27, 80)
  17. 30 divides 2160 (2160 ÷ 30 = 72) → pair (30, 72)
  18. 36 divides 2160 (2160 ÷ 36 = 60) → pair (36, 60)
  19. 40 divides 2160 (2160 ÷ 40 = 54) → pair (40, 54)
  20. 45 divides 2160 (2160 ÷ 45 = 48) → pair (45, 48)
  21. Collect all unique values: {1, 2, 3, 4, 5, 6, 8, 9, 10, 12, 15, 16, 18, 20, 24, 27, 30, 36, 40, 45, 48, 54, 60, 72, 80, 90, 108, 120, 135, 144, 180, 216, 240, 270, 360, 432, 540, 720, 1080, 2160} — total 40 divisors.
  22. Sum: 1 + 2 + 3 + 4 + 5 + 6 + 8 + 9 + 10 + 12 + 15 + 16 + 18 + 20 + 24 + 27 + 30 + 36 + 40 + 45 + 48 + 54 + 60 + 72 + 80 + 90 + 108 + 120 + 135 + 144 + 180 + 216 + 240 + 270 + 360 + 432 + 540 + 720 + 1080 + 2160 = 7440.

What Is a Divisor?

A divisor (also called a factor) of a positive integer n is any positive integer d such that n ÷ d has no remainder. In other words, d divides n evenly.

Every positive integer n has at least two divisors: 1 and n itself (with 1 being the trivial case of having only itself). Numbers with exactly 2 divisors are prime; numbers with 3 or more divisors are composite.
